Predictive and prognostic factors associated with unliquefied pyogenic liver abscesses

摘要

Poor liquefaction of pyogenic liver abscesses, which makes drainage impossible at the time of diagnosis, is not infrequent. The impact of poor liquefaction and subsequent drainage failure on clinical outcomes is unknown.We conducted a retrospective study with all patients diagnosed with liver abscesses from July 2017 through June 2020. Late drainage (LD) was defined as drainage performed ≥48 h after diagnosis due to poor liquefaction. Logistic regression was performed to identify the factors associated with late or non-drainage (LD/ND). The Cox proportional hazard model was used to identify the variables related to abscess recurrence by 90 days after diagnosis.A total of 153 patients were included. Thirty (19.6%) patients underwent LD and 54 (35.3%) did not undergo drainage. Other than non-cystic appearance, LD/ND was associated with smaller size (adjusted odds ratio [aOR] 0.85, 95% confidence interval [CI] 0.73-0.98, p = 0.031) and culture-negativity (aOR 2.69, 95% CI 1.14-6.67, p = 0.027). Current hepatopancreaticobiliary malignancy was the only significant predictor of 90-day recurrence. Neither LD/ND (OR, 0.56; 95% CI, 0.13-2.41; p = 0.426) nor LD (OR, 1.26; 95% CI, 0.23-5.55; p = 0.719) was associated with recurrence by 90 days. The incidence of late complications was reduced by drainage, without a reduction in the duration of hospitalization.Several clinical features were associated with undrainable liver abscesses. Neither LD/ND nor ND had an adverse impact on clinical outcomes.
